Output 24a7ac6318ca707f331988ed59bdaf59794f12c1e1638c9e94c08d2bdcae84f7:8

value
435448531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fb266cbf9c2c39a68b72b88330cbe24a8bc8ae3 OP_EQUAL
address
3GFR5brffsYiL2rNmfVZ5dSyKWFB6oHdky
transaction
24a7ac6318ca707f331988ed59bdaf59794f12c1e1638c9e94c08d2bdcae84f7
spent
true